Just How Does Family Members Therapy Aid?
In family treatment, family members consult with a licensed psychological health expert, often a psychologist or social worker with unique training in family therapy. Some specialists use certain techniques, such as mirroring, to show families exactly how to connect better.


Various other therapists might utilize family members education, such as enlightening participants concerning psychological wellness problems that influence their enjoyed ones. This can aid families support each other throughout tough times and find solutions together.

Relationships
Family therapy teaches families how to communicate better and deal with conflicts. This enhances the high quality of connections within the family and can benefit interpersonal relationships outside the family, as well.

Family therapists make use of strategies like empathetic listening to motivate members to reveal their sensations without judgment. They also show participants to listen diligently and react thoughtfully, promoting an environment of understanding and connection. Non-verbal hints like eye contact, nodding, and clenched fists are likewise vital to consider when interacting with member of the family.

Family therapy is commonly used to deal with a variety of concerns, including mental disorder, drug abuse, persistent health conditions, grief, and monetary problems. Nonetheless, the effectiveness of this type of treatment might rely on the commitment of family members to take part and the specialist's skill in assisting them. It can be hard to break through the protected facade lots of family members put up, particularly if one member of the family is resistant to the process.

Problems
Problems are a regular part of life, yet when they're constant or unsolved, they can stress family relationships. Family therapy assists you learn much healthier ways to interact and solve problems, so you can build stronger bonds with your loved ones.

During sessions, your counselor will provide a safe space for discussion of the issues that cause tension in your family. They'll additionally assist you establish healthy and balanced coping strategies to address future difficulties.

Several family members have harmful interaction patterns, such as preventing conflict, turning to shouting, or moving blame to other members of the family. In these instances, the specialist may use some psychodynamic approaches, such as interpreting household vanity defenses and intergenerational trauma, to assist all relative acquire new understanding right into their dynamics. These methods, however, can be time consuming and call for the participation of several family members. This can sometimes cause the specialist's countertransference and result in them taking sides, which can hinder the therapeutic process.

Interaction
A family therapist can aid a family learn just how to communicate much better, specifically during tough discussions. Family therapy can additionally aid member of the family develop healthy coping skills and find much more efficient methods to deal with problems.

The specialist might use various techniques, depending upon the household's requirements. These include role-playing exercises, directed discussions and collective analytical activities. The therapist may likewise motivate open communication by demonstrating healthy listening and assertiveness skills.

Psychoeducation is another common component of family therapy. This involves teaching member of the family about mental wellness problems, including their reasons, signs and treatment. According to one 2018 study, when families understand mental wellness problems, their participants have a tendency to have a much more positive outlook and experience less regressions. The specialist might likewise show relative stress-reduction techniques, such as mindfulness and meditation. This can help them cope with daily stress and anxieties, such as job and home life. It can additionally help them better take care of a liked one's mental disorder.
